MALDI-TOF MS/microwave-assisted acid hydrolysis identification of HbG Coushatta
1Chemistry Department, University of Alberta, Canada.
Objective:
To evaluate the effectiveness of microwave-assisted acid hydrolysis of proteins combined with MALDI-TOF MS to characterize hemoglobin G Coushatta.
Design And Method:
Following separation of the globin chains, the purified beta chain fractions were hydrolyzed by acid hydrolysis prior to MALDI-TOF MS.
Results:
The method correctly identified the abnormal amino acid in HbG Coushatta. The results of this method were confirmed by an established de novo sequencing method.
Conclusion:
The correct amino acid sequence for HbG Coushatta was found. The proposed method is an alternative to MS/MS methods available for identification of abnormal hemoglobin variants.
